'It is nothing unusual': £45,000 a week Premier League player Cheick Tiote defends decision to have two wives AND a mistress
A married Premier League footballer who has two wives and a mistress has defended his lifestyle by claiming it is nothing unusual.
Cheick Tiote, who earns £45,000 a week playing for Newcastle United, reportedly wed Laeticia Doukrou in a traditional ceremony this month, despite already being married to first wife Madah, 25.
The 28-year-old midfielder, who currently lives with Madah and their two children in a £1.5million mansion in Ponteland near Newcastle, also has a one-year-old child with mistress Nikki Mpofu.
Newcastle United midfielder Cheick Tiote recently married Laeticia Doukrou, despite the fact he is already married to his first wife Madah (pictured together left), and has a young child with mistress Nikki Mpofu (right)
+6
His agent today confirmed reports he had got married for a second time.
Jean Musampa said: 'I can say that he did get married and that it is his second marriage.
'This is nothing unusual. He is a Muslim.'
The footballer, who can have four wives under Islamic law, is also said to have insisted to friends that having several partners is commonplace in his native Ivory Coast.

Its perfectly acceptable in his culture. He doesnt see he has done anything wrong and doesnt know what the fuss is all about.
It is reported that his 33-year-old Zimbabwean mistress Ms Mpofu recently ended her three-year affair with the footballer after he allegedly promised to make her his wife.

The Sun reported that she was comfortable with him being married but decided to call the relationship off because he used me like a mop.
She was pictured earlier this week leaving a Waitrose store in Ponteland, Newcastle, with her and Tiotes son Rafael.
Tiote was spotted a day earlier leaving his home in the same village with his first wife Madah, who is said to have forgiven him for marrying another woman.
Newcastle United was not available for comment.
Tiote received interest from Lokomotiv Moscow during the summer and was thought to be keen on a move to Russia.
He remained on Tyneside after Lokomotiv failed to make an acceptable offer but his contract is set to expire in 2016.
